Bermuda Run Country Club - Course 2 in Bermuda Run



This club has three nine hole courses that are played in three eighteen hole combinations. The Bronze Course has many sand bunkers and trees that can affect your shots. The Gold Course doesn't have as much water as the other two courses, but it still has its share of difficulties. The Silver Course has the most water hazards. These courses have large greens and plenty of fairway bunkers.
